Understanding K2 Spray: What is it and Why is it Dangerous?

K2 or Spice, Synthetic Cannabinoid Spray, This Product is a harmful blend of substances that have been infused with synthetic chemicals, often meant to mimic the effects of marijuana. But, these chemicals are far more potent and can produce severe adverse reactions. The danger stems from the constantly changing chemical composition – manufacturers often change the compounds to evade prohibition, resulting in unforeseen and potentially fatal outcomes. Users often think they are consuming something relatively safe, but K2 often leads to a range of alarming symptoms, including seizures, psychosis, nausea, and even organ failure. Because of its unpredictable nature and associated risks, K2 represents a major public danger.
